The photo realism that people are able to achieve with colored pencils is something to behold, especially when you are a talented artist like Australia’s Cj Hendry. She’s gone completely meta when it comes to optical illusions in art. Not only is she using colored pencils to create a photo realistic illustration, but the subject of her art is another medium for art, oil paint. The images are part of her new series called, Complimentary Colors. Amazingly, this is also one of Hendry’s first forays beyond drawing in black and white and into the world of color.
